NY: Farrar, Straus & Giroux. Very Good in Very Good dust jacket; Page tops soiled.. 1973. First Printing. Hardcover. Blue cloth. xi, 252pp. Illustrated endpapers, foreword, black and white photo section, and index. Reminiscences and anecdotes from an assistant cameraman on some of D. W. Griffith's major films. ; 8vo 8" - 9" tall .

Old Saratoga Books owners Dan and Rachel Jagareski have been selling books since 1996. After running an open shop for twenty years in the historic village of Schuylerville we now sell books online and at book fairs. We are members of the Independent Online Booksellers Association (IOBA). Our specialties include books about history, science, cooking, children's books, and the arts. Rachel is a graduate of the Colorado Antiquarian Book Seminar and has attended Rare Book School in Charlottesville, Virginia.
